Death and Landscape

Luke Steel

Death is used to generate dense landscape conditions onsite. Each deceased is designated a light in the field that remains illuminated for one year.  Power is generated in a Microbial Fuel Cell using the organic matter of the body. This cycle is succinct with the human grieving process. After one year has elapsed the light diminishes, signifying the end of the process. A small amount of compostable remains are then used as the basis of new life in the plantation. Although the cycle is complete, the memory of the deceased always lives on and mourners can always revisit the tree where the deceased is situated.
